a) cos^2 A - cos^2 B b) tan^2 A - tan^2 B c) tan^2 A - tan^2 B d) sin^2 A - sin^2 B please show the steps you take to get to the answer! thank you
sin (a-b) = sin a cos b - cos a sin b product sin^2 a cos^2 b - cos^2 a sin^2 b now divide by cos^2 a cos^2 b sin^2 a/cos^2a - sin^2 b/ cos^2 b = tan^2 a - tan^2 b
